# Compaction threshold for the Thistlequeue log segments.
# Segments above this byte count are eligible for key-based
# compaction; tombstones persist one full cycle before removal.
# Reviewer note: compaction never rewrites in place — old
# segments are retained until the swap commits, so no window
# exists where acknowledged data is unrecoverable. Behavior
# was verified against the build identified by the token below.

build token for yajof-bajof: htk31_506ff1188f74596b5bb2eec94edc43c

Cache invalidation for the Thornmere product catalog is provenance-bound: every cache entry records the catalog build that produced it, and entries are purged only when a newer attested build is published. Reviewers should verify that purge events reference signed build manifests, not wall-clock TTLs, since TTL-based expiry was removed in the Larkfen migration. To audit a specific invalidation wave, match its manifest against the build token recorded below.

pipeline stamp: htk9_ce63042d9

## Auth for load tests

If you're on call and the Cartwheel checkout load test starts failing with 401s, don't panic — it's almost always the auth layer, not the checkout service itself. The load rig hits the Fennelworth staging gateway, which requires a bearer token on every simulated purchase. Tokens expire every six hours, so mid-run failures usually mean the token aged out. Regenerate via the ops console and restart the run. Use the staging token below.

session JWT of yawep-yawep = eyJhbGciOiJIUzI1NiIsInR5cCI6IkpXVCJ9.eyJzdWIiOiI3pWF3_In0.aXYsHiog